Key Responsibilities:
Manage a diverse portfolio of complex cases, prioritising and resolving issues independently. Conduct property valuations and lead on acquisitions and disposals, ensuring effective outcomes. Provide guidance and support to team members, showcasing your leadership skills. Embody our client's values and behaviours, contributing to a positive work environment.
Essential Requirements:
A degree in Estate Management or equivalent, with membership in the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ors (MRICS) preferred. Post-qualification experience in a commercial organisation or local authority. Strong IT skills, with proficiency in word processing, databases, and spreadsheets. Excellent communication and organisational abilities, with a knack for prioritising tasks. Effective negotiation skills that lead to successful outcomes.Desirable Skills:
Registered Valuer qualification is a plus! Familiarity with various methods of marketing, disposal, and acquisition of land and buildings. Knowledge of local government practices and procedures.
